The work done in taking an ideal gas through one cycle of operation as shown in the indicator diagram below

- A \(10^{-5} \mathrm{~J}\)
- B \(10^{-3} \mathrm{~J}\)
- C \(10^{-2} \mathrm{~J}\)
- D \(10 \mathrm{~J}\)
Answer & Solution
Correct Answer
(D) \(10 \mathrm{~J}\)
Step-by-step Solution
Detailed explanation
As work done in a cycle is equal to the area enclosed by the cycle. \(\therefore \quad\) Work done, \(W=\Delta p \times \Delta V\) \[ =(4-2) \times(6-1)=10 \mathrm{~J} \]
